Pipers compete at UW-La Crosse

The Pipers finished fourth at the Gershon/McLellan Invitational at UW-La Crosse on Friday night. UW-La Crosse led the field with 185.425 points, Winona State was second with 183.625 points, UW-Oshkosh had 177.800 points in third place, and Hamline finished with 174.575 points.

Brynn Stenslie (Jr., Renton, Wa.) finished third on the balance beam with a score of 9.650 for the top Piper finish.

Kristen Weniger (Jr., Eagan, Minn.) placed fifth in the floor exercise with a score of 9.275, while Sarah Prosen (Fy., Apple Valley, Minn.) was tied for sixth with 9.250 points in the same event. 

The Pipers next compete at the University of Minnesota in the Best of Minnesota meet on Saturday, February 9. The meet also includes Gustavus and Winona State.
